1、服務(wù)器編程:以前你如果使用C或者C++做的那些事情,用Go來做很合適,例如處理日志、數(shù)據(jù)打包、虛擬機處理、文件系統(tǒng)等。分布式系統(tǒng)、數(shù)據(jù)庫代理器、中間件:例如Etcd。
成都創(chuàng)新互聯(lián)是專業(yè)的七里河網(wǎng)站建設(shè)公司,七里河接單;提供網(wǎng)站建設(shè)、成都網(wǎng)站建設(shè),網(wǎng)頁設(shè)計,網(wǎng)站設(shè)計,建網(wǎng)站,PHP網(wǎng)站建設(shè)等專業(yè)做網(wǎng)站服務(wù);采用PHP框架,可快速的進行七里河網(wǎng)站開發(fā)網(wǎng)頁制作和功能擴展;專業(yè)做搜索引擎喜愛的網(wǎng)站,專業(yè)的做網(wǎng)站團隊,希望更多企業(yè)前來合作!
2、Go作為Google2009年推出的語言,其被設(shè)計成一門應(yīng)用于搭載 Web 服務(wù)器,存儲集群或類似用途的巨型中央服務(wù)器的系統(tǒng)編程語言。對于高性能分布式系統(tǒng)領(lǐng)域而言,Go 語言無疑比大多數(shù)其它語言有著更高的開發(fā)效率。
3、Go語言主要用作服務(wù)器端開發(fā)。其定位是用來開發(fā)“大型軟件”的,適合于需要很多程序員一起開發(fā),并且開發(fā)周期較長的大型軟件和支持云計算的網(wǎng)絡(luò)服務(wù)。
第一個:Beego框架 Beego框架是astaxie的GOWeb開發(fā)的開源框架。Beego框架最大的特點是由八個大的基礎(chǔ)模塊組成,八大基礎(chǔ)模塊的特點是可以根據(jù)自己的需要進行引入,模塊相互獨立,模塊之間耦合性低。
我認為是適合的,我建議你可以去后盾網(wǎng)問問看,哪里有好多教學視頻,資料也很多。
Go語言主要用作服務(wù)器端開發(fā),其定位是用來開發(fā)“大型軟件”的,適合于很多程序員一起開發(fā)大型軟件,并且開發(fā)周期長,支持云計算的網(wǎng)絡(luò)服務(wù)。
它們通常都是被當成第二語言,做一些輔助開發(fā)的工作。其中Python只在極少數(shù)情況下,才被用來作為主要開發(fā)語言。至于Go與Ruby,我目前還沒聽說過它們有被當作主要開發(fā)語言的例子。我所推薦的是從C#和JAVA兩者之間,二選一。。
從web的角度來看,這四個語言都做過web開發(fā),不過后來php代替了perl。而現(xiàn)在作為python的django構(gòu)架和ruby的Ruby On Rails構(gòu)架正在逐漸代替php。因為php也有其天生的缺憾,例如對于模板分離式編程不是天生的支持導(dǎo)致的。
Python是一種通用的高級編程語言,它具有簡潔、高效的語法,擁有豐富的標準庫和第三方庫,能夠快速開發(fā)原型和實現(xiàn)復(fù)雜的功能。JavaScript是一種跨平臺的腳本語言,可以用于前端和后端開發(fā),有大量優(yōu)秀的框架和工具可以使用。
從廣義上來講,所有用戶終端產(chǎn)品與視覺和交互有關(guān)的部分,都是Web前端工程師的專業(yè)領(lǐng)域。就目前Web前端開發(fā)可能涉及的語言來講,有PHP語言、JavaScript、Ruby、HTMLJava和Python。
python適合以下幾個方面:【W(wǎng)eb開發(fā)】Python擁有很多免費數(shù)據(jù)函數(shù)庫、免費web網(wǎng)頁模板系統(tǒng)、以及與web服務(wù)器進行交互的庫,可以實現(xiàn)web開發(fā)搭建web框架。